the TX DC offset keep the same in difference TX attenuation setting?

Dear sir:

         i measure the TX DC offset in difference TX attenuation setting, i found that it almost remain the same power -56dBm~-59dBm. But the IQ mismatch power will decrease when attenuation increase. why? Is there no TX DC offset tracking mechanism  in AD9361?

         i also see description in the <AD9361_Calibrations_v2.3> document, the TX monitor calibration has the TX DC offset calibration function too? or the TX DC offset calibration only contain in the TX QEC process? But the TX monitor calibration is unused default in driver.

        how can i reduce the TX DC offset in difference attenuation step? 

